TypeScript ORM for Node.js based on Data Mapper, Unit of Work and Identity Map patterns. Supports MongoDB, MySQL, PostgreSQL and SQLite databases as well as usage with vanilla JavaScript.

import { MikroORM } from '@mikro-orm/better-sqlite';
import { Filter, FilterValue, Project, Risk } from './entities';
import { DatabaseSeeder } from './seeder';
let orm: MikroORM;
beforeAll(async () => {
orm = await MikroORM.init({
entities: [Project, Risk, Filter, FilterValue],
dbName: ':memory:',
});
await orm.schema.createSchema();
const seeder = new DatabaseSeeder();
await seeder.run(orm.em);
orm.em.clear();
});
afterAll(() => orm.close(true));
test('perf: serialize nested entities', async () => {
const risks = await orm.em.find(Risk, {}, { populate: ['*'] });
const project = await orm.em.findOneOrFail(Project, { id: 1 });
// Serialize a collection of 150 entities
console.time('perf: serialize risks');
const stringRisks1 = JSON.stringify(risks);
console.timeEnd('perf: serialize risks');
// Serialize an entity with the same collection of 150 entities as above
// Next extract the 150 entities, giving the same result as stringRisks above
console.time('perf: serialize project');
const stringProject = JSON.stringify(project);
const stringRisks2 = JSON.stringify(JSON.parse(stringProject).risks);
console.timeEnd('perf: serialize project');
// See that the stringified results are the same
expect(stringRisks1).toBe(stringRisks2);
});
